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Brand Value
Value: The brand value of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d., denoted by the ticker symbol 2206T, is estimated at approximately ¥84.9 billion (about $771 million) as of the latest fiscal year. This significant brand value enhances customer loyalty, enabling the company to command premium pricing across its diverse product portfolio, which includes confectionery, snacks, and dairy products.
Rarity: A strong brand presence in the Asian snack and confectionery market is rare, as it requires considerable time and investment to cultivate. Ezaki Glico has established its brand through decades of innovative marketing and product development since its founding in 1922, setting it apart from competitors.
Imitability: Imitating Ezaki Glico's brand value is particularly challenging. This difficulty stems from the necessity of replicating customer perceptions and experiences cultivated over many years. The company invests heavily in research and development, with an average annual expenditure of approximately ¥5 billion (around $46 million) in recent years to maintain its competitive edge and foster brand loyalty.
Organization: Ezaki Glico is well-organized, ensuring consistent brand messaging across all channels. The company has implemented structured customer engagement strategies, including a robust online presence and active participation in social media, which have increased its interaction rate by around 25% over the past two years.
Competitive Advantage: The competitive advantage held by Ezaki Glico is sustained. Its brand value is difficult to replicate, serving as a core differentiator in a highly competitive market. The company reported a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.4% in revenue from 2018 to 2022, demonstrating its ability to maintain brand strength and market presence.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Intellectual Property
Value: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. holds over 1,000 patents globally, particularly in confectionery and health food sectors, ensuring exclusive rights to key innovations. In 2022, the company's revenue was approximately ¥365 billion (around $3.2 billion), significantly benefiting from its proprietary products.
Rarity: The Glico brand is synonymous with unique products such as Pocky, which dominates the snack market with over 50% market share in Japan. Certain flavor combinations and production techniques are covered by patents, creating a barrier to entry for competitors.
Imitability: Legal protections underpinning Glico's intellectual property create high barriers to imitation. The time and cost associated with developing similar proprietary technologies can exceed ¥10 million per patent application, deterring potential competitors.
Organization: Ezaki Glico has a dedicated IP management team that focuses on maximizing commercial returns from its assets. In 2022, the company invested approximately ¥3.8 billion in R&D, underlining its commitment to innovation and effective IP utilization.
Competitive Advantage: The combination of extensive legal protections and a strong brand identity provides Glico with a sustained competitive advantage. The company has continuously posted a net profit margin of around 6.5% over the past five years, showcasing the effectiveness of its IP strategy.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Supply Chain Efficiency
Value: Ezaki Glico’s efficient supply chain plays a critical role in reducing operational costs. In fiscal year 2022, the company reported a revenue of ¥ 510.9 billion (approximately $4.6 billion), reflecting a strong focus on enhancing delivery times and reducing waste. This efficiency results in a higher customer satisfaction rate, with Glico products consistently ranking highly in consumer surveys.
Rarity: The supply chain optimization tailored to specific market demands is moderately rare. Most competitors operate on standard supply chain practices, while Glico's adaptation to local markets, especially in Asia, sets it apart. The company has established regional distribution centers that cater to local consumer preferences, a strategy that is not prevalent among all competitors.
Imitability: While competitors can replicate aspects of Glico's supply chain efficiency, achieving the same level of optimization involves significant investment. For instance, Glico's logistics technology investments exceeded ¥ 2.4 billion in 2022. The partnerships formed with local suppliers and distributors create a network that is difficult to reproduce without similar capital and strategic commitment.
Organization: Glico demonstrates strong organizational capabilities, utilizing advanced technologies such as AI and data analytics in its supply chain management. The company reported a 15% improvement in logistics efficiency in 2022, attributed to its focus on using cutting-edge technology. Their ability to integrate supply chain partners effectively is evident in their operational metrics.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Research and Development (R&D)
In the context of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d., the company's research and development (R&D) capabilities reflect a robust strategy aimed at fostering innovation. In the fiscal year ending March 2023, Glico invested approximately ¥7.5 billion in R&D activities, which accounted for about 2.5% of its total sales revenue. This significant investment underlines the company's commitment to developing new products and refining existing ones to better satisfy customer preferences.
The rarity of high-performing R&D departments like that of Ezaki Glico stems from the substantial resources and specialized expertise required to operate effectively. As of 2023, only 15% of companies in the food industry allocate more than 2% of their revenue to R&D, highlighting the competitive edge Ezaki Glico maintains in this aspect. This positioning signifies a rare capability that contributes to the company’s overall innovation potential.
In terms of imitability, replicating Ezaki Glico’s R&D success is challenging. Achieving a similar level of innovation demands considerable investment in both skilled personnel and advanced R&D infrastructure. The company employs over 300 R&D professionals and operates multiple R&D facilities, including the Glico Group Research Institute, which boasts state-of-the-art technology and resources dedicated to product development.
Organizationally, Ezaki Glico effectively allocates resources toward its R&D efforts. The company employs a structured approach to project management and innovation strategy, utilizing insights from its customer base and market trends to drive development. The R&D department works closely with marketing to ensure that new products align with consumer demands, which enhances the efficacy of their innovations.
The competitive advantage derived from Ezaki Glico's R&D investments is sustained through a continuous cycle of innovation. The company's successful launches, including the Glico Pocky variations and the new Glico Almond Chocolate, have contributed to a 7.3% increase in sales in the snack segment over the past year. This continuous introduction of innovative products ensures that the company remains ahead of its competitors in the market.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Human Capital
Value: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. invests significantly in its human capital, boasting a workforce of approximately 3,000 employees as of 2023. The company reported a revenue of ¥339.5 billion (roughly $2.3 billion) for the fiscal year ending March 2023. Skilled and knowledgeable employees are pivotal in driving innovation, with R&D expenses amounting to ¥8.5 billion, which underscores their commitment to developing new products and enhancing operational efficiency.
Rarity: The competitive landscape for specialized talent is intense. Glico's focus on niche markets, such as premium confectionery and health-oriented snacks, requires expertise that is not only rare but highly sought after. This has led to a talent acquisition strategy that emphasizes collaboration with universities and research institutions to secure top-tier talent in food science and product development.
Imitability: While competitors may attempt to hire skilled employees, replicating the comprehensive expertise of Glico’s workforce is a formidable challenge. The synergy of team dynamics, corporate knowledge, and historical expertise within the company creates a barrier that is difficult to overcome. Glico has cultivated a unique corporate culture that emphasizes innovation and teamwork, which cannot be easily mimicked.
Organization: Glico has implemented effective human resource policies that include continuous training programs, mentorship, and employee engagement initiatives. In 2022, the employee retention rate was reported at 92%, reflecting a strong organizational structure that nurtures talent and fosters loyalty. The company’s management philosophy encourages an atmosphere where employees feel valued and motivated to contribute their best work.
Competitive Advantage: The sustained competitive advantage derived from human capital results from Glico’s strong corporate culture. Despite potential turnover, the integration of talent retention programs ensures that the company continues to attract and maintain highly skilled employees. Glico’s corporate identity is closely linked to its employee satisfaction, as evidenced by their ranking in the Top 100 Best Companies to Work For in Japan.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Financial Resources
Value: For the fiscal year ending March 2023,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. reported total revenue of JPY 332.1 billion (approximately USD 2.5 billion). The company's operating profit was JPY 33.9 billion, demonstrating a strong capacity to invest in growth opportunities and innovative technologies.
Rarity: The company held cash and cash equivalents totaling JPY 37.5 billion as of March 2023. Although financial resources aren’t rare in the industry, having significant reserves such as these provides a competitive edge when seizing market opportunities.
Imitability: As of 2023, Ezaki Glico's net income stood at JPY 22.8 billion. This level of profitability indicates a strong capital position that competitors may find challenging to replicate, especially smaller entities with limited resources.
Organization: The company's return on equity (ROE) for the fiscal year 2022 was 10.3%, reflecting effective financial management and an optimal allocation of capital. The firm efficiently directs its resources toward strategic areas, such as increasing production capacity and enhancing marketing efforts.
Competitive Advantage: Ezaki Glico has shown a temporary competitive advantage based on its financial positioning. For instance, during the COVID-19 pandemic recovery phase, the company capitalized on increased demand for snacks, leading to a revenue growth of 8.5% year-on-year in 2023. However, this advantage may fluctuate with changing market dynamics and economic conditions.

Ezaki Glico Co., Ltd. - VRIO Analysis: Distribution Network
Value: Ezaki Glico boasts a well-established distribution network that enhances product availability and ensures timely delivery. As of 2022, the company reported a net sales figure of approximately JPY 348 billion, primarily driven by efficient logistics and distribution strategies.
Rarity: The customized distribution networks of Ezaki Glico are tailored to high-demand regions, making them rare. The company maintains distribution channels that reach over 30 countries, establishing a footprint that is difficult for new entrants to replicate.
Imitability: Building an extensive distribution infrastructure similar to Ezaki Glico's is costly and time-consuming. For example, in 2021, Glico invested around JPY 8 billion solely in enhancing its logistics capabilities, which adds to the barriers for competitors attempting to replicate such a network.
Organization: Ezaki Glico effectively utilizes strategic partnerships, collaborating with major logistics firms and utilizing advanced technology to streamline operations. The firm leverages a fleet of over 1,000 delivery vehicles paired with a robust inventory management system that reduces delivery times by 15%.
Competitive Advantage: The sustained competitive advantage lies in the complexity and reach of the established distribution network, which requires significant time and financial investment to match. The company's distribution efficiency contributed to a 9.5% operating profit margin in 2022, reflecting the effectiveness of their logistics strategy.
